Sustained-release and controlled-release drug delivery systems can reduce the undesired fluctuations of drug ranges, For that reason diminishing Unwanted effects though improving upon the therapeutic results of the drug. The phrases sustained release and controlled release confer with two distinctive varieties of drug delivery systems (DDS), Despite the fact that they tend to be used interchangeably. Sustained-release dosage varieties are systems that elongate the period of your motion by decreasing the release of the drug and its pharmacological motion. Controlled-release drug systems are more innovative than just simply just delaying the release fee and so are intended to deliver the drug at specific release premiums inside of a predetermined time frame.

Liposomes are tiny, spherical, self-shut buildings with no less than 1 concentric lipid bilayer and an encapsulated aqueous stage in the center. They have been widely employed as drug delivery autos because their discovery in 1965 because of their biocompatible and biodegradable character as well as their exceptional capacity to encapsulate hydrophilic agents (hydrophilic drugs, DNA, RNA, etcetera.) in their internal aqueous core and hydrophobic drugs throughout the lamellae, that makes them adaptable therapeutic carriers. Moreover, amphiphilic drugs can also be loaded into your liposome inner aqueous core working with remote loading procedures, including the ammonium sulfate strategy for doxorubicin70 or perhaps the pH gradient process for vincristine71. On the other hand, one of several major drawbacks of these typical liposomes was their immediate clearance in check here the bloodstream. The development of stealth liposomes is underway by utilizing the area coating of a hydrophilic polymer, typically a lipid by-product of polyethylene glycol (PEG), to increase the circulation fifty percent-lifetime of liposomes from under a couple of minutes (regular liposomes) to quite a few several hours (stealth liposomes)72. Liposomes hold the possible to focus on particular cells as a result of both Energetic and passive concentrating on techniques. PEGylated liposomes are actually identified to become more practical at passively focusing on most cancers cells both of get more info those in vitro As well as in vivo than common liposomes, and What's more, PEGylated liposomes show a superior diploma of nuclear transfection. Liposomal antisense oligonucleotides (ASO) have already been located being effective for that inhibition of pump and nonpump resistance of multidrug resistant tumors73.

The term modified-release drug merchandise is made use of to describe items that change the timing and/or the speed of release of your drug substance. A modified-release dosage type is often a formulation in which the drug-release qualities of your time study course and/or location are picked to accomplish therapeutic or advantage targets not made available from standard dosage types for example alternatives, ointments, or instantly dissolving dosage sorts.
